Think Global Shop Local

11/21/2017

 
​I stopped cooking professionally in 2012, and the last place I was had field to fork on the menu. We had a seasonal menu that we would fully revamp four times a year. It was a challenge that kept me on my toes and offered some great opportunities in food. Just think of how creative and healthy you can cook if you get to roll with the seasons. We also had a CSA that distributed shares at our facility, so we would often get some wonderful surprises, like 300lbs of Hubbard squash. 

But if I am honest sourcing local produce was a massive pain in the ***. Just finding someone to buy from required a large amount of time. Know who has enough product, then getting it delivered (or picking it up for yourself). 
Luckily Ryan has been doing some research and found some really cool resources to help people. We will be rolling these and other tips and tricks as we find and vet them. Because it’s hard enough to start your food truck. 

This a directory provided by the state that you should check out. ( the link doesn't work all the time so paste and go)
